HomeMy WebLinkAboutOrdinances_1257_CCv0001.pdf ORDINANCE NO. 1257
AN ORDINANCE AMENDING ZONING ORDINANCE NO. 1000 OF THE CITY OF
REDLANDS BY ADOPTING AMENDMENT NO. 52 THERETO
The City Council of the City of Redlands does ordain as
follows:
SECTION ONE: That Zoning Ordinance No. 1000 of the City of
Redlands be and is hereby amended by adopting Amendment No.
52 - Civic Design District - which amends a section as
follows :
SECTION 22. 62 - C-D CIVIC DESIGN DISTRICT
See. 22.61 Purpose
The purpose of the Civic Design District shall be to
promote the orderly harmonious development of areas of the
community adjacent to the Civic Center, parks, or other
buildings or areas of special interest to the public, and to
insure that the appearance of the areas surrounding such
facilities shall be maintained at a high standard.
See. 22.62 Superimposed Nature of Civic Design District
The Civic Design District shall be in the nature of a
super-imposed zone. Land classified in the Civic Design
District shall also be classified in one or more other basic
zones. Property so classified shall be delineated on the
Zoning Map by a combination of the zone symbols (for example
C-3 C-D) . The regulations set forth in these sections on the
Civic Design District shall be in addition to the regulations
set forth in the underlying zone. In the event of a conflict
between the provisions of the Civic Design District and the
provisions of an underlying zone, the provisions of the Civic
Design District shall control.
Sec. 22.63 Permitted, Accessory and Conditional Uses
The principal permitted uses, accessory uses, and
conditional uses shall be the same as those set forth in the
basic underlying zone.
Sec. 22.64 Regulations
Development Plan Approval by the Planning Commission shall
be required in the Civic Design District for any of the following:
1. Erection of a structure other than residential.
2. The moving of a structure onto the property or within
the property.
3. A structural alteration which would substantially
change the exterior appearance of a structure.
4. Erection or substantial alteration of a sign, wall or
fence.
5. The installation or alteration of outdoor lighting
equipment which would substantially change the exterior
appearance of the use or structure.
6. Wherever an outdoor use is established, enlarged or
changed to another use.
Sec. 22,65 Commission Consideration
In addition to other considerations in regard to develop-
ment plan approval, the Planning Commission shall take into
consideration the following criteria in studying the plans and
elevations of proposed buildings and uses in the Civic Design
District:
1. The general exterior appearance of the buildings,
including height, bulk, size and shape.
2. The color and texture of surface materials.
3. The relationship to existing buildings and structures
in the area.
4. Consideration should also be given to probable future
uses and structures in the area, based on the General
Plan, precise plans or redevelopment plans for the
area.
5. The setbacks and landscaping of yard areas.
6. The design, size , type and location of all signs, walls,
fences and outdoor storage.
7. The illumination of buildings , grounds, parking areas
and signs.
8. Any other feature or item having a direct relationship
to the general appearance of the buildings and premises.
Sec. 22.66 Consultation
If the Commission desires, it may request the advice and
consultation of a committee of qualified architects appointed
by the Council.
Sec. 22.67 Commission"s Action
The Commission shall have the authority to disapprove any
proposed building or structure or any change in an existing
building or structure which, in its opinion, would have detri-
mental effect on the appearance of the area under consideration.
The Commission may require changes in the architectural treat-
ment of buildings or structures and may require additional
landscaping and development improvements as are necessary in its
judgment to carry out the intent and purpose of the Civic Design
District.
Sec . 22 . 68 Consultation with Developers
In the event that the Planning Commission determines that
changes or alternations are needed, the Commission or its desig-
nated representative shall confer with the developer in an
endeavor to have the plans changed so that the structures and
uses of the premises will be harmonious and attractive in appear-
ance and at the same time fulfill, the needs of the developero
Sec . 22.69 Utilities
All utilities and utility installations shall be under
ground. However, the planning Commission may waive this
requirement when it is found that said requirement would be
unreasonable or impractical.
